Qa Analyst Resume
MiamI
SUMMARY
- Over six years of diverse IT experience with strong emphasis on Quality Assurance and Testing.
- Excellent understanding of the SDLC, its constituent Activities & steps, Models & the supporting Disciplines.
- Extensive experience in all steps of STLC; performed Requirements Analysis, Test Preparation, Test Execution, Defect Management and Management Reporting.
- Thorough hands on experience with all levels of testing namely Smoke, Sanity, Integration, Backend, Interface, Functional, Regression, Performance, e - commerce testing, Volume and Compatibility testing.
- Expertise inSeleniumAutomation testing usingSeleniumWebDriver,Selenium Grid and Java.
- Actively participated in the requirement gathering & JAD Sessions which involved the Project Sponsors, Project Managers, BAs, development team & test team.
- Expertise in Path Analysis & Data Flow Analysis and writing test cases from the basic, alternate, and exceptional flows of the Use cases.
- Prepared and maintained RTMs, FRMs and PR reports to ensure comprehensive test coverage of requirements.
- Strong Data validation and Database testing skills using SQL
- Extensive experience in both Manual and Automated testing using Quality Center/Test Director and Clear Quest.
- Extensive experience in tracking bugs using Bug tracking tools such as Test Director/ Quality Centre and Clear Quest.
- Performed manual as well as automation testing of the application. (QTP, UFT)
- Substantial experience in writing and executing Test cases and Test Scripts,
- Working close with overall team to meet project goals.
- Worked closely with Project Managers, Scrum Master on the implementation of new changes and infrastructures including operational readiness, change preparation, change execution, and post-change QA validation.
- Used need baseSQL querieslikeselect, insert, update, deleteand joining multiple tables based on business requirement to conduct backend testing.
- Constantly involved in the cross functional team to adopt QA Testing Standards, Trace, Log defects and reporting using HP ALM and Rally.
- Involved and responsible for creating Daily and weekly status reports regarding the progress of testing process.
- Analyzed Business requirement specification andSystem Requirementsspecification, and involved in design, development and execution of manual and automation test scripts.
- PreparedTest Plan, Test Case, and Test Scriptsas per Functional and Business requirement for System/Functional Test Specification
- Coordinated and prioritized outstanding defects and enhancement based on business requirements, allowing sufficient time frame to ensure accuracy.
- Expertise in generating & analyzing management reports.
- Ability to multitask and very flexible in adjusting to people, circumstances and responsibility, hardworking with an ambitious & realistic attitude.
- Participated in weekly Assessment Meetings with BAs, Developers and Project Managers.
- Good knowledge of finance, insurance business, Ecommerce, Mortgage terminology, Telecom applications and processes.
- Ability to multitask, flexible in adjusting to people, hard working with a realistic attitude, good interpersonal skills and a team player.
TECHNICAL SKILLS:
Software Process: SDLC, RUP, Agile Method
Testing Tools: Quick Test Pro, Rational Functional Tester, SOAP, Rational Manual Tester, Win Runner, ALM, TOAD
Databases: Oracle 10g 11g, Microsoft SQL Server, Sybase, MS Access
Languages: SQL, UNIX Shell, VB, Java, XML, HTML, CSS
Web Technologies: ASP.NET, VB.NET, VBScript, JavaScript
Developer Tools: TOAD, SQL*Plus, Rapid SQL, Adobe Photoshop.
Authoring Tools: MS Word, MS Power Point, MS Excel, MS Project, Visio
Operating Systems: Windows NT/XP/2000/98, UNIX, Linux
PROFESSIONAL EXPERIENCE:
Confidential
QA Analyst
Responsibilities:
- Involved in almost all stages of Software Development Life Cycle from requirements gathering to final regression testing of the application
- Analyzed system test requirements, Business Requirements and generated test cases and test scripts.
- Participated in HLD (high level design), DLD (detail level design) review discussions with business, development and architecture teams
- Created Test planning documents like Path Analysis, Table of Paths, Data Criteria for some of the major modules of the application.
- Responsible for creating & maintenance of Automation scripts for the core web services using SOAP UI Pro tool.
- Designed and implemented different frameworksPage Objects framework, Hybrid Framework and Data driven framework
- Proven ability inQTPAutomation usingQTP,UFT and QC
- Solid experience on writing Automation scripts usingSeleniumWebDriver 2.44 and QTP-Java and VB Script
- Created automation scripts for both REST & SOAP based web services
- Validated the different types of responses like JSON, XML, RSS by adding assertions
- Validated the responses in multiple ways using XPATH, Groovy scripts
- Responsible for writing extensive groovy script assertions for RESTFUL services with JSON responses
- Used Excel as a data source for the data inputs and used groovy scripts to import those data in to SOAP UI tool
- Participate in DRB meetings to get the defects resolved in efficient and timely manner.
- Written detailed test cases and test scenarios in ALM
- Carried out extensive backend using SQL queries for verification of Data Transactions, Data Validation and Data Integrity in Oracle.
- Performed System, Integration, Regression, and Compatibility Testing.
- Worked onAgileSoftware Development environment where performed testing in each sprint.
- ParticipatedinSprint Analysis Meeting, Sprint Retrospective, Showcase and Daily Scrum.
- Automated different Functional Test case usingQTP, VBScript, Check Point, ParameterizationandDescriptive Programming
- Designedanddeveloped Test Automation Framework for SciCast Regression Suite usingHP UFT.
- Customized UFT Scripts with Parameterization, Check Points, Library Files, and Regular Expression to automate functional Test Cases
- Designed the Test Strategy for multiple projects, Defect Management usingQC/ALM.
- Worked closely with Product and Project Managers on the implementation of new projects and infrastructures including operational readiness, change preparation, change execution, and post-change QA validation.
- Developed test plan, test cases, executed test cases, logged defects and provided testing signoff
- Performed all phases of testing like System Testing, Integration Testing, Regression Testing, and UAT Testing.
- Worked on QTP Framework and modified necessary Framework components
- Design & develop data driven framework to validate different Member profile using QTP, VBScript & Descriptive Programming
- Involved in generating Vuser in Load Runner for performance testing, and load testing of the application.
- Both of UNIX & Linux environments to analyze log file & to monitor process.
- Worked thoroughly tested the data synchronization module and verified transactional documents & import export reports.
- Interacted with developers to follow up on defects and issues.
- Processed batch jobs in UNIX environment manually. Used to analyze the failures/logs to drill down to the root cause and provide solutions accordingly
- Developed SQL scripts to run complex data integrity test cases for inbound/outbound interfaces testing
- Logged and tracked defects using Rational Clear Quest
- Maintained Requirement Traceability Matrix (RTM) by mapping the requirements in DOORS with test cases.
- Created and maintained test plans that define test objectives, methods and tools to be employed for the assigned project.
- Communicated with the developing team and created periodical status reports. Involved in Extensive testing of various situations along with the implementation team, resolved the issues and problems.
- Participated in status, review meetings and Served as an integral member of the QA test team, including testing other features/products whenever necessary.
- Designed the Test scenarios so that the achievement of the functional requirement is tested with positive, Negative conditions
Environment: Windows XP, Oracle 11g, UAT, Selenium, Visio, HP ALM, Mercury Quick Test Pro (QTPv9.2) Rational Clear quest, Rational Clear Case, SharePoint, Java, J2EE, Oracle, UNIX, SOX.
Confidential, Miami
QA Analyst
Responsibilities:
- Involved in writing Test Plan for the testing effort of the module
- Developed and executed Test Cases and Test Scripts based on the requirement documents and managed it using Quality Center
- Reviewed test cases after requirement changes or enhancements, monitored requirement changes
- Conducted manual backend testing to validate query results
- Created functional routines and verify their reliability to ensure compliance of business rules and propagation of data definitions
- Performed Sanity Testing, Smoke Testing, Positive and Negative Testing and Usability Testing for the BOA Banking module.
- Performed Data Driven Testing, Functional Testing, System Testing, and Security Testing.
- Writing Test Plan, Test Strategy, Test Cases, Test Results, Quality documents, for Functional Testing, Integration Testing, Web services Testing and Regression Testing
- Responsible for the design & creation of the web services automation scripts using SOAP UI Pro tool
- Validated both the SOAP & REST based web services using SOAP UI Pro tool
- Used Excel as a data source input for the entire test and parameterize those on the POST Method.
- Validated the different types of response like XML, JSON
- Used groovy to read the data source from the properties and also from the Excel
- Responsible for execution automated test in SOAP UI daily & publish the status
- Created a functionality test matrix of test scenarios from business requirements and use cases.
- Wrote and executed test cases in Quality Center and test scripts after reviewing business required document and technical specifications.
- Prepared UAT test execution report and defect management report to management.
- Involved End to End testing of FACETS Billing, Claim Processing and Subscriber/Member module.
- Set claim processing data for different FACETS Module.
- Tested HIPAA Compliance/Regulations in FACETS HIPAA privacy module.
- Conducted Back-End Testing manually for the purpose of Database Integrity.
- Defect Tracking and Bug Reporting using Quality Center.
- Developed Test Scripts in SQL to check the data integrity from the databases
- Conducted Result Analysis and interacted with developers to resolve bugs.
- Interacted with developers, business analysts and discussed technical problems and reported bugs.
- Met with the developers and technical content writers on a daily basis to update the test documents.
- Created and maintained the Traceability Matrix and Test Matrix. .
- Bug Reporting and Tracking using Mercury Quality Center
- Performed User Acceptance Testing (UAT)
- Generated defect reports using Mercury Quality Center and presented using MS Office tools
- Interfacing with developers to resolve the technical issues
- Processed batch jobs in UNIX environment manually.
- Conducted End-to-End Testing using QTP with other testers.
- For Security Testing, ensured entrance and exit criteria for the QA test phases are completed
- Developed and reviewed complex SQL queries, views, function, and stored procedures to perform the Back-End Testing of the data.
- Conducted Negative and Positive testing manually.
- Used Quality Center for tracking and reporting defects found during the Functional and Regression Testing.
- Developed SQL queries, functions, stored procedures and triggers to perform the backend testing of the data.
- Created RTM and performed GAP Analysis.
- Regularly met with team leads, other team members and developers to evaluate the project progress.
Environment: Window 7, Oracle, SQL, Quality Center, UAT, QTP, MS Office, Internet Explorer, MS Project, UNIX.
Confidential, Chicago
QA Analyst
Responsibilities:
- Involved in reviewing and verifying the Business Requirements Documents and Test Plans
- Developed Test cases and Test Scripts to fully validate the functionality, and ensured that the application meets all the security requirements
- Develops and/or helps develop risk based test strategies and Plans
- Automated test scenarios for GUI, Functionality and performed Regression on the application inserting different data.
- Created and maintained SQL Scripts to perform back-end testing on the oracle database.
- Expected and Actual results were maintained in a live Test Matrix throughout the Testing life cycle.
- Involved in Web Services testing using SOAP UI
- Validated the JSON and XML response using the SOAP UI tool
- Validated the response using the assertions steps and also used XPATH & groovy scripting
- Responsible for Black box testing of the application.
- Performed analysis on data through excels pivot tables
- Responsible for System, Integration, and Regression testing
- Performed backend testing using SQL queries to ensure that the data is being sent correctly and the files are being generated correctly.
- Responsible for reporting software defects, validating the fix, and closing the defects
- Executed Smoke test and Regression tests on weekly builds
- Developed detailed security testing requirements for the application
- Worked closely with testers and developers to develop comprehensive test documentation
- Analyze and help resolving user support issues
- Develop process efficiencies for project testing phases through revising test documents to match requirement documents
- Create and follow through to completion issues found within the application
- Participate in weekly stand up team lead meetings, provided test status, and updated the test team members with the status on the project.
Environment: Java, HTML, Windows XP, Perl, Shell Scripts, Mercury Quality Center, SQL Server.
